I just have a 1/2 ton. I just want to lower the front and leave the rear stock. Has a 292 inline 6.

Just remember to take the caster angle into account when lowering the front only,as caster is lost it can cause a nervous/twitchy steering response.
It can be easily adjusted with shims.
